Transaction faec25912094c71bcb900aaeddeafd15ef799ae1dca0d627720a002a846e29eb
2 Input
2 Outputs
- faec25912094c71bcb900aaeddeafd15ef799ae1dca0d627720a002a846e29eb:0
- faec25912094c71bcb900aaeddeafd15ef799ae1dca0d627720a002a846e29eb:1
value 1145742
address 13PUtzTKDBdjyLAdkkTGEX4ih1pfyQNCXa
value 25622080
address 1APBJBuhABTprmk6ZPxXj2pYvPHabXMkuJ